Squeaky Wood Floor Repair Questions
Why does a wood floor squeak? Squeaks often occur when floorboards rub against each other or when nails loosen, causing movement that creates noise during foot traffic.
What causes squeaky wood floors? Common causes include expansion and contraction of wood, loose nails or staples, and subfloor movement beneath the surface.
Can squeaky floors be fixed without replacing the entire floor? Yes, many squeaks can be resolved through targeted repairs such as tightening nails, adding shims, or applying lubricants to reduce movement.
Is it better to repair squeaks early or wait? Addressing squeaks promptly helps prevent further damage and maintains the integrity of the flooring over time.
